概括
尼泊尔青少年的自杀行为是一个关键问题,严重的心理健康危机加剧了这一问题. 迫切需要采取合作行动,以应对不断上升的自杀率,并支持处于危险的年轻人.

背景情况:
- 青少年的自杀行为在尼泊尔是一个日益严重的公共卫生问题.
- 国家面临着长期的心理健康危机,需要立即和统一的干预.
- 官方统计不充分记录自杀企图,只关注已完成的案件.
研究的目的:
- 为了突出尼泊尔青少年中自杀行为的升级率.
- 强调需要从社会各个部门立即采取协调一致的行动.
- 为了引起人们对自杀企图的幸存者的注意,作为更广泛问题的指标.
主要方法:
- 对官方自杀统计数据的分析.
- 在尼泊尔西部的一家三级医院观察病例.
- 心理健康危机背景的定性评估.
主要成果:
- 完成的自杀率正在正式上升.
- 幸存下来的自杀企图,特别是在青少年和年轻人中,揭示了一个令人担忧的趋势.
- 目前的数据可能低估了真正的自杀倾向的流行率.
结论:
- 在尼泊尔,有迫切和公认的需要解决青年自杀问题.
- 必须采取包括国家机构,医疗保健提供者和社会在内的综合性方法.
- 进一步的研究和干预策略对于预防自杀的努力至关重要.

Long-term depression, or LTD, is one of the ways by which synaptic plasticity—changes in the strength of chemical synapses—can occur in the brain. LTD is the process of synaptic weakening that occurs over time between pre and postsynaptic neuronal connections. The synaptic weakening of LTD works in opposition to synaptic strengthening by long-term potentiation (LTP) and together are the main mechanisms that underlie learning and memory.
